Why Walking Becomes Difficult
Poor Blood Circulation
When vein valves fail, blood pools in the lower legs instead of returning efficiently to the heart. This causes heaviness and fatigue during walking.
Increased Pressure in Legs
Pressure buildup in the veins leads to discomfort, swelling, and reduced stamina while moving.

Treatment Options Supporting Mobility
Compression Therapy
Compression stockings support blood flow and reduce discomfort during movement.
Minimally Invasive Procedures
Laser treatment and sclerotherapy close damaged veins, improving circulation and mobility.
Surgical Options
In advanced cases, surgery may be used to restore proper vein function.
